实验过程

To a 500 ml erlenmeyer flask with magnetic stirrer was charged 10.3 g of 3-nitro-4-methoxy-methylbenzoate, 400 ml tetrahydrofuran, and 3.2 g of 86% potassium hydroxide. The reaction was stirred for 12 hours at ambient temperature, after which the resulting solid was collected by vacuum filtration and washed with 2×100 ml of ethyl ether. The solid was dissolved in 200 ml of water and acidified to pH 4 with 6N hydrochloric acid. The resulting precipitate was collected by vacuum filtration, washed with 200 ml water, and dried overnight in vacuo at 30° C. Isolated 7.4 g of product as a white solid.
